I haven't found a good recipe for bread but I make cheese crackers as a substitute. Mix Almond flour with two or three tablespoons of grated parmesan and a little salt. Add a little cold water to make a dough like slightly sticky pastry. Roll and cut into rounds then roll each one a bit more and bake in  a fairly hot oven for  20 minutes until golden but not brown. All the almond baking seems to burn very easily. They last a few days and can be rewarmed to make them crisper.

I also separate the eggs in the cake and muffin recipes and then whisk the whites before adding them at the end. It gives a much lighter texture.
